Bullying- In order to minimize bullying and encourage teamwork, our goal is to help students gain skills and knowledge in a safe and positive learning community. The faculty, staff, and students achieve this by modeling positive behavior, using common language, improving communication, and encouraging community involvement.
Bullying is . . .
- Intentional harm-doing
- Happens repeatedly over time
- Verbal: name calling, threatening and/or rumors; profanity
- Emotional: making faces, isolating others, gestures
- Unequal power (size, ability, popularity, money, clothing)
- Physical: kicking, pushing, and hitting someone else to hurt someone
School Rules Against Bullying- Students should be aware of their surroundings and should follow these four steps.
- We will not bully other students.
- We will try to help students who are bullied.
- We will make a point to include students who are easily left out.
- When we know somebody is being bullied, we will tell an adult at school and an adult at home.
